Flat and apartment moves are often more technical than a standard house move. Shared entrances, upper floors, timed access, permit parking and limited lift space can all affect how the day needs to be planned. We take those details into account before the move so the loading and unloading can be done safely and efficiently.
Whether you are moving out of a city-centre apartment, a converted building or a first-floor flat, we keep the service careful and organised. Furniture is protected, boxes are loaded sensibly and the team works around the building rather than slowing everyone else down.
